Castro County, TX — April 10, 2023, one person was injured due to an accident involving an explosion at a dairy farm outside of Dimmitt.
Authorities said that the incident happened late Monday approximately 11 miles outside of town. The cause is still under investigation. An explosion somehow occurred, trapping several workers. Rescue teams were able to extract everyone.

It appears at least one worker was injured, with reports saying that person was flown to a hospital for treatment. Right now, additional details remain unclear.
